Senior Magnetic Resonance Imaging Technologist Salary in Providence, RI: $137,400 (2026)

Quick Answer:The top tier of magnetic resonance imaging technologists working in Providence, RI — those at or above the 90th percentile — pull in $137,400/year or more for 2026, based on BLS OEWS 2025 estimates for SOC 29-2035. Strip back Providence's price premium (BEA RPP 101.8, 2% above national) and that top-decile pay carries the same buying power as $135,006 in average-cost America. The 22% spread above city median typically rewards 7+ years of practice or specialty credentials.

Top-earning magnetic resonance imaging technologists (90th percentile) in Providence saw their compensation grow 22.9% from $106,420 in 2019 to $130,820 in 2025, based on 7 years of BLS OEWS data for this metropolitan area. At a 5.03% annual growth rate, senior-level pay is projected to reach $144,311 by 2027, reflecting continued demand for clinical expertise and expanded-function credentials.

Maximizing Your Magnetic Resonance Imaging Technologist Earnings in Providence

Specializations within the MRI field are key to maximizing earning potential in Providence. For instance, those who focus on neuroradiology, cardiac MRI, or pediatric MRI can command premium pay, enhancing their senior magnetic resonance imaging technologist pay in RI. Moreover, compensation can vary significantly based on the type of healthcare employer—hospitals, outpatient imaging centers, mobile MRI services, and orthopedics all offer different pay scales and benefits. Career advancement options abound for seasoned professionals; roles such as lead MRI technologist, MRI modality supervisor, or applications specialist with major vendors can elevate both responsibilities and compensation. Holding advanced certifications like the ARRT(MR) or MRSO can also provide a competitive edge in a robust job market. Additionally, non-salary factors like shift differentials, travel premiums, and on-call pay at trauma centers contribute to overall compensation, making Providence a lucrative location for established MRI technologists seeking to optimize their earnings in 2026.
